The MCP Gherkin Server is a tool for generating Gherkin feature files using the Model Context Protocol.
The MCP Gherkin Server is designed to facilitate the creation of Gherkin feature files programmatically. By leveraging the Model Context Protocol (MCP), it provides a robust interface for handling requests and responses, making it an ideal solution for developers looking to integrate Gherkin file generation into their applications. The server is built to be user-friendly and efficient, allowing users to define their data and receive Gherkin syntax in return. This capability is particularly useful for teams practicing Behavior-Driven Development (BDD), as it streamlines the process of creating and managing feature files.
